解锁小程序逻辑架构秘籍速成高质感界面设计
|
小程序的逻辑架构是构建高效、稳定应用的核心,理解其结构有助于开发者快速定位问题并优化性能。通常,小程序采用分层设计,包括视图层、逻辑层和数据层,每一层都有明确的职责分工。 在视图层中,WXML 和 WXSS 负责页面布局与样式,它们类似于网页开发中的 HTML 和 CSS。通过合理的组件化设计,可以提升代码复用率,减少冗余代码,使界面更易维护。 逻辑层主要由 JavaScript 实现,处理用户交互、数据请求和业务逻辑。良好的模块划分可以让代码更清晰,例如将数据处理、网络请求和事件管理分别封装成独立的模块,提高可读性和可扩展性。
AI渲染的图片,仅供参考 数据层则涉及全局状态管理和本地存储,合理使用 App.js 中的 globalData 或者第三方状态管理工具,可以有效避免数据混乱,提升用户体验。高质感界面设计不仅依赖于视觉效果,更需要逻辑与交互的完美配合。例如,动画效果应与数据更新同步,避免出现卡顿或延迟,确保用户操作流畅自然。 同时,响应式设计和适配不同屏幕尺寸也是提升界面质感的重要因素。通过灵活使用 flex 布局和媒体查询,可以让界面在各种设备上保持一致性。 掌握小程序的逻辑架构与界面设计技巧,能够帮助开发者打造更专业、更高效的项目。不断实践与总结经验,是提升技能的关键。 (编辑:汽车网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

